About us

Established in 2011, Samsung SDS Smart Logistics (part of the Korean multinational Samsung Group) is one of the fastest growing logistics service providers in the world and specializes in innovative logistics services by developing and applying optimized solutions and providing SCM consultancy to customers based on their own Cello platform. The company is active worldwide in 40 countries employing more than 4.500 logistics experts.

Purpose of the job

This role will be based in our newly opened warehouse in Born.  You will be reporting directly to operations excellence performance lead. Key activities for this role include:

 

  • Identifying opportunities in the supply chain processes for improvement on service, quality and cost with specializing on warehouse processes;
  • Supporting the set-up of the BI tool (testing, prepare initial reports, adjust reports, align with operations and customer on reports/dashboards etc.);                                                                                                                                                                                       
  • Drawing up a business case about (your) ideas for improvement, with which you convince stakeholders to set up the processes differently;
  • Collecting data and setting up improvement processes after data analysis;
  • Preparing, improving and implementing new and existing processes while motivating the team to work with you;
  • Prepare reporting tools/templates for Key performance indicators towards internal stakeholders as well as customers
  • Standardization of processes across different teams and areas and training of site employees
  • Overseeing SOP (Standard operating procedures) follow up on the floor and conducting internal audits of the processes
  • Switching with different stakeholders to ensure that everyone is on the same page;
  • Being responsible for reports on processes and/or projects;
  • Coaching peers who have become enthusiastic about process improvement and helping them in independently tackling (small-scale) process improvements.
